PLAYER OF THE WEEK: Pitt-Bradford OH Riley Anderson led the Panthers in the tough Ginny Hunt Kilt Classic at Wooster College, going 2-2 at the event while earning wins against Bethany and Oberlin. The Panthers also defeated Houghton earlier in the week at home. Anderson put together a big week hitting for the Panthers, logging 4.42 kills per set and 84 total. She hit at a .225 percentage and twice knocked 20 kills in a single match. In addition, she's a vital part of the Panther defense as she registered 72 total digs, averaging 3.79 digs per set. Anderson averaged 4.7 points per set on the week. 

 

BEST OF THE REST: Mount Aloysius OH Machala Gibbons broke the MAC record of kills per match with 33 total kills, while also leading her team to a 4-2 week, including the program's first win over Hood College, while averaging 3.23 kills per set and and 3.59 digs per set...La Roche OH Laura Nath averaged 3.2 kills per set as the Redhawks went 2-1 on the Week, sweeping both matches at the Clarks Summit Trimatch...PS-Behrend OH Amanda Henry averaged 2.75 kills and 1.75 digs in four matches last week, including double-digit kills in three matches, while recording a double-double with 12 kills and 14 digs against Fredonia...PS-Altoona OH Kaitlin Cassidy totaled 13 kills (1.63 kills per set), 13 digs (1.63 digs per set), nine service aces (1.13 aces per set), and 22.5 points (2.8 points per set) in two non-conference games last week, as her seven aces against Chatham was a career-high mark for her...Medaille MB Lindsey Howell played well both offensively and defensively for Medaille last week, leading the Mavs with 33 kills and six total blocks.
